Description - This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with the format in FAR Part 12.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ation. Quotations are being requested and a separate written solicitation will not be issued. Solicitation number 1232SA26Q0463 is issued as a Request for Quotation (RFQ) for a cattle chute. This acquisition is set-aside for small business concerns. The applicable North American Industry Classification Standard Code is 333111 The small business size standard is 1,250 employees This acquisition is a Total Small Business Set-Aside. All responsible sources may submit a quotation which will be considered by the agency. Statement of Requirement The USDA, ARS in El Reno, OK requires an Arrowquip Powerlock 108, or comparable cattle chute that meets or exceeds the following, and the additional requirements listed in the attached specification sheet: Squeeze opens to at least the 31.5" Hydraulic Power Unit, 5HP Electric (Single Phase) Award Type The Government intends to make one award from this solicitation. Therefore, to be considered responsive, contractors must submit pricing for all items. Evaluation and Basis for Award The provision at FAR 52.212-2, Evaluation—Commercial Products and Commercial Services is not applicable to this solicitation. In lieu of this provision, quotes will be evaluated in accordance with FAR 12.203 based on the criteria listed below. Award will be made to the offeror representing the best value to the Government. The Government will conduct a comparative evaluation of quotes to select the Contractor that is best suited to fulfill the requirement. The Government may focus its detailed evaluation on those quotes determined most likely to represent the best value to ensure administrative efficiency. The evaluation factors are: Price and Technical Capability. The Government reserves the right to select a quote that represents a superior technical solution, even if it is not the lowest priced. Submission Requirements : To be considered, provide a quote on company letterhead including: Vendor Details : SAM.gov UEI Number. Technical Documentation : Descriptive material (e.g., manufacturer spec sheets or brochures) and a "meets/does not meet" statement for the minimum specifications. Offerors must specifically highlight or reference the page/section in their literature that verifies compliance with each requirement. Pricing: Unit price and total price (including all shipping/delivery costs). Timeline : Estimated lead time/delivery date. Validity : Quote must be valid for at least 60 days. Offerors shall identify where the offered item meets or does not meet each of the Government's functional and performance minimum specifications listed herein.
